currently I am working on a Qt application running on an Embedded platform (i.MX53).
My problem is, that while this app is running, I cannot make my system suspend.
I am using "busybox rtcwake" to administer the suspend funktion, which i would like to just run from my Qt app, as this app is the main reason for my system, but I cannot seem to make the system go to suspend when calling rtc wake:
//From Qt app.
Qstring str = "/bin/busybox rtcwake -d /dev/rtc0 -m standby -s 15";
system(str.toAscii());
this just gets me this message:
wakeup from "standby" at Sun Jun 24 20:59:00 2012
PM: Syncing filesystems ... done.
which should be something like:

wakeup from "standby" at Sun Jun 24 22:22:02 2012
PM: Syncing filesystems ... done.
Freezing user space processes ... (elapsed 0.01 seconds) done.
Freezing remaining freezable tasks ... (elapsed 0.01 seconds) done.
mxc_ipu mxc_ipu: Channel already disabled 9
mxc_ipu mxc_ipu: Channel already uninitialized 9
PM: suspend of devices complete after 28.942 msecs
suspend wp cpu=400000000
PM: late suspend of devices complete after 0.726 msecs
Because this is what is says when I run the busybox command while the qt app is not running.
*Note: I'm running Linux: 2.6.35.3-11.09.01
Does anyone know what could be the problem?
